Transaction dc107da5f674f0fc83b3390ae4acce7a65e64e9ce032cab430d7768ca6deba59

block
50e3cdcd851e211e2891a03d269b8681f8410fe6827b9aebde1553cc1a9c2d9e

3 Inputs

21 Outputs